Beyond weight loss: sleep data unlocks new GLP-1/GIP drug indications — Beacon Biosignals analysis

Beacon Biosignals9/15/2025·09/15/25🌐 USA

Summary

Beacon Biosignals published an analysis demonstrating that their Waveband EEG-based sleep monitoring system can identify CNS pharmacodynamic effects of GLP-1/GIP receptor agonists (semaglutide, tirzepatide) through specific changes in sleep architecture biomarkers. The analysis found distinct EEG sleep stage changes in patients on GLP-1 therapy versus controls, raising the hypothesis that GLP-1's neurological effects — including mood improvement and cognitive benefits reported by patients — may be detectable and quantifiable through EEG sleep biomarkers before cognitive tests would be sensitive enough to show changes.

Why it matters

Beacon's GLP-1 sleep biomarker analysis positions their EEG platform at the intersection of the world's largest drug class (GLP-1 agonists) and the rapidly emerging field of GLP-1 neuroprotection. If EEG sleep biomarkers can prospectively identify patients who will respond best to GLP-1 neuroprotection in Parkinson's — or quantify the CNS efficacy of GLP-1 drugs in real time — Beacon would become essential infrastructure for the entire GLP-1 CNS pipeline.
